Quick Technical Datasheet
| Part Number | Q62P ✅ Ready to Ship |
| Manufacturer | Mitsubishi Electric |
| Series | MELSEC-Q |
| Input Voltage | AC 100–240 V (allowable: 85–264 V) |
| Input Frequency | 50 / 60 Hz |
| Output Voltage | DC 5 V |
| Output Current | 6 A |
| Rated Output Power | 30 W |
| Inrush Current | Max. 30 A @ 200 VAC |
| Power Hold Time | ≥ 20 ms after AC loss |
| Efficiency | ≥ 70% |
| Operating Temperature | 0 to 55 °C |
| Storage Temperature | −20 to 75 °C |
| Humidity | 5–95% RH, non-condensing |
| Dielectric Withstand | 1500 VAC (AC terminals to chassis) |
| Insulation Resistance | ≥ 10 MΩ @ 500 VDC |
| Dimensions (W×H×D) | 55 × 98 × 90 mm |
| Weight | Approx. 0.44 kg |
| Compatible Base Units | QnB, QnSB, QS034B (Safety) |
| Certifications | UL, cUL, CE (EMC + LVD), RoHS |
| Country of Origin | Japan |

Troubleshooting & Replacement Tips
Common failure signatures that point to a dead Q62P:
- All module LEDs on the base unit extinguish simultaneously — not a single module fault, the entire rack loses power.
- CPU module shows no POWER LED but AC input to the Q62P is confirmed live with a multimeter. This rules out upstream breakers and isolates the fault to the PSU itself.
- Intermittent system resets correlating with ambient temperature spikes above 45 °C — classic sign of a thermally degraded capacitor bank inside the Q62P.
- GX Works3 / GX Developer throws “SP.UNIT DOWN” or “MODULE VERIFY ERROR” immediately after power-on — often caused by the Q62P failing to hold the 5 VDC rail stable during the CPU’s self-check sequence.
- Audible high-frequency whine from the PSU slot with no output — switching transistor failure, the module must be replaced, not repaired in the field.
Step-by-step hot-swap replacement procedure:
- Isolate AC input. Open the dedicated MCB feeding the Q-series cabinet. Verify zero voltage at the Q62P AC terminals with a CAT III meter. Do not rely on the main cabinet isolator alone — confirm locally.
- Record the current program state. If the CPU is still partially functional, use GX Works3 to read and save the current program and device memory to a laptop before cutting power. This takes 90 seconds and can save hours of re-commissioning.
- Remove the faulty Q62P. Loosen the two M4 screws on the module front plate. Pull the module straight out — do not rock it sideways, the backplane connector is fragile. Inspect the connector pins on the base unit for burn marks or bent contacts before inserting the replacement.
- No DIP switch or address configuration required. The Q62P is a passive power supply — it has no node address, no firmware, and no parameter settings. Slot it in, tighten the screws, and restore AC power.
- Verify output voltage. With AC restored, measure DC 5 V at the base unit’s test points (refer to the QnB hardware manual, Section 3). Acceptable range: 4.75–5.25 V. If outside this range with a new module, suspect a shorted load on the 5 V bus — isolate modules one by one.
- Check power budget before restart. If you are adding modules to the rack post-repair, recalculate the 5 V current draw. The Q62P supports 6 A total. Use Mitsubishi’s module current consumption table (available in the MELSEC-Q Hardware Manual, IB-0800335) to confirm you are within budget. Exceeding 6 A will trigger the overcurrent protection and the system will not start.
- Restore and verify. Write the saved program back to the CPU, switch to RUN mode, and monitor the first 10 scan cycles for any I/O errors. Check the System Monitor in GX Works3 for any residual module errors.
Compatibility note: The Q62P is a direct mechanical and electrical replacement for the Q61P (3 A / 15 W) and Q63P (6 A / 30 W with 24 VDC auxiliary output). If your original unit was a Q63P and you needed the 24 VDC auxiliary rail for external sensors, the Q62P will not provide that rail — order the Q63P instead. Confirm your part number from the module label before ordering.
Reliability in Harsh Conditions
The Q62P was designed for continuous duty in environments that would kill consumer-grade electronics within weeks. Here is what it handles without derating:
- Thermal cycling: Rated 0–55 °C operating range with internal thermal management. In automotive paint shops where ambient temperatures swing from 20 °C at startup to 50 °C at peak production, the Q62P maintains output regulation within ±1% across the full range. The internal switching topology is optimized for low self-heating, which directly extends capacitor life — the primary aging component in any SMPS.
- Vibration and mechanical shock: Compliant with IEC 61131-2 vibration testing (10–57 Hz, 0.075 mm amplitude; 57–150 Hz, 1 g). In press-shop environments where the floor vibrates continuously from 800-ton stamping presses, Q-series racks with Q62P power supplies have demonstrated multi-year MTBF without connector fatigue failures — provided the base unit is properly mounted on DIN rail with end stops.
- Humidity and condensation: Rated 5–95% RH non-condensing. The conformal coating on the internal PCB provides additional protection against humidity ingress in coastal or tropical installations. For installations where condensation is unavoidable (cold-store logistics, outdoor enclosures), add a cabinet heater to maintain internal temperature above the dew point — the Q62P alone is not rated for condensing environments.
- Electrical noise immunity: The Q62P’s switching frequency and output filtering are tuned to suppress conducted emissions below CISPR 11 Class A limits. In steel mills and arc-furnace facilities where the power grid carries significant harmonic distortion, the wide input range (85–264 VAC) absorbs voltage sags and swells that would trip narrower-range supplies. The built-in EMI filter on the AC input side prevents switching noise from propagating back into the plant grid.
- Overcurrent and overvoltage protection: Automatic fold-back current limiting protects both the Q62P and the downstream modules during a bus short. Recovery is automatic once the fault is cleared — no manual reset required, no fuse to replace in the field.
